Advice from the Law Society is that settlement­s be deferred until after the Alert Level 4 restrictio­ns are lifted. Even though banks and lawyers are essential services, vendors and purchaser will not be able to move in and out of their homes. However, conditiona­l contracts can still be confirmed provided no travel or face-to-face meetings are required. If a condition cannot be satisfied during the Alert Level 4 period arrangemen­ts can be made to extend the condition until after the lockdown period. The party’s lawyers will make the appropriat­e changes to the agreement to facilitate this.
